Battery Life vs. Storage Space

  • Would you rather have a phone that lasts 3 days on a single charge but only has 32GB of storage, or a phone that needs charging every 6 hours but has unlimited storage?
  • Would you rather have to carry a portable charger everywhere you go but have a phone with the best battery life on the market, or have a phone with terrible battery life that you have to charge constantly but never need a charger?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that magically recharges itself whenever you're not looking at it, but the screen is always slightly dim, or a phone with a battery that dies in 2 hours but has the brightest, clearest screen possible?
  • Would you rather have to manually plug in your phone for 12 hours every night to get a full charge, or have a phone with a battery that lasts 2 days but is prone to overheating?
  • Would you rather have a phone with an amazing battery that never dies, but you can only use it for 1 hour a day, or a phone with terrible battery life but you can use it 24/7?
  • Would you rather have a phone that runs out of battery the moment you need it most for an emergency, or a phone that has 100% battery but makes annoying beeping noises every 5 minutes?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that lasts a week but takes 24 hours to charge, or a phone that charges in 10 minutes but dies after 2 hours?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you have to physically shake it to charge it, or a phone with a battery that lasts 10 hours but is the size of a brick?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that lasts forever but the phone is incredibly slow, or a phone that is super fast but the battery dies in an hour?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you can only charge it using solar power, or a phone where the battery lasts 2 days but you can't use any apps?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that never depletes but the screen is always foggy, or a phone with a crystal clear screen but the battery dies if you play a game for more than 5 minutes?
  • Would you rather have a phone that automatically shuts down at 50% battery, or a phone that requires you to watch 30 seconds of ads every time you want to check your battery level?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that lasts a month but can only connect to Wi-Fi, or a phone with an all-day battery that only works on 2G data?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you have to manually swap out battery packs every few hours, or a phone with a battery that only charges when you sing to it?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that lasts 3 days but has no sound, or a phone with an all-day battery that constantly plays a tiny, annoying jingle?
  • Would you rather have a phone that you can only charge by plugging it into another device, or a phone with a battery that lasts 8 hours but causes your hand to get slightly tingly?
  • Would you rather have a phone where the battery health slowly degrades over time to the point where it’s unusable in a year, or a phone with a battery that lasts 2 days but drains the battery of any nearby device?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that's immune to heat but drains twice as fast in the cold, or a phone with a battery that's terrible in heat but works perfectly in the cold?
  • Would you rather have a phone with a battery that takes 24 hours to charge but lasts two weeks, or a phone with a battery that dies in 15 minutes but you can recharge it by rubbing it vigorously?
  • Would you rather have a phone where the battery lasts a year but you can only use the flashlight, or a phone with an all-day battery but the phone only has one app installed?

Privacy Controls vs. Convenience Features

  • Would you rather have a phone that locks down your privacy so intensely that you have to re-enter your password for everything, or a phone that's incredibly convenient but shares your location with advertisers?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you have total control over every single app's access to your data, but it takes 10 minutes to set up each new app, or a phone where everything is automatically shared for convenience but you have no idea what's happening with your data?
  • Would you rather have a phone that has end-to-end encryption for all your calls and messages, but you can never use cloud backups, or a phone with easy cloud backups but your communications are accessible to the company?
  • Would you rather have a phone that requires you to physically sign a consent form every time an app wants to use your microphone, or a phone that lets apps use your microphone whenever they want without asking?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you can see exactly what data every app is collecting and you can block it, but the interface is incredibly complex, or a phone with a simple "allow all" button for apps?
  • Would you rather have a phone that blocks all ads and trackers but sometimes makes websites not load correctly, or a phone that shows you all ads and trackers but everything works perfectly?
  • Would you rather have a phone that uses facial recognition to unlock, but the company stores your facial scan, or a phone that uses a fingerprint, but it sometimes glitches and requires a passcode?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you can delete any app's data at any time with a single tap, but you have to re-download them, or a phone where app data is automatically cleared after 30 days without your control?
  • Would you rather have a phone that alerts you every single time your location is accessed, even by a map app, or a phone that never alerts you about location tracking?
  • Would you rather have a phone that automatically turns off your camera and microphone when the screen is off, but it drains the battery faster, or a phone where they are always active but the battery lasts longer?
  • Would you rather have a phone that prevents any background app activity unless you explicitly allow it, but notifications might be delayed, or a phone that allows all background activity for instant notifications but has potential privacy risks?
  • Would you rather have a phone that makes you log in with a two-factor authentication every time you turn it on, or a phone that unlocks with just a swipe but might be vulnerable?
  • Would you rather have a phone that doesn't store any of your search history or browsing data, but it’s much slower, or a phone that learns your habits to be faster but keeps a detailed log of everything?
  • Would you rather have a phone where you can manually approve every single permission for every app, or a phone where you just click "agree" to all permissions?
  • Would you rather have a phone that periodically asks you to confirm your identity for security reasons, or a phone that never bothers you but might be less secure?
  • Would you rather have a phone that uses a PIN that is impossible to guess but also impossible to remember, or a phone that uses an easy PIN but could be easily compromised?
  • Would you rather have a phone that constantly backs up your data to a secure server you control, or a phone that offers convenient cloud backups but you don't know who has access to them?
  • Would you rather have a phone that requires you to sign a digital waiver before downloading any app, or a phone that lets you download whatever you want instantly?
  • Would you rather have a phone that allows you to disable cookies entirely but some websites won't work, or a phone that accepts all cookies for maximum website compatibility?
  • Would you rather have a phone that has a strict "no data sharing" policy for all apps, but some apps might not function fully, or a phone that encourages data sharing for improved app experiences?
